Output 2e26976d25586891d30fe4e4e50a089ce6da5e365374d9a9e538cd757babe6e9:126

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6666994389a68ac297d2719ffd2a0aa4971ed5a4d5b24d2e798e2b3b10b75a6b
address
bc1pvenfjsuf569v997jwx0l62s25jt3a4dy6key6tne3c4nky9htf4spep9w8
transaction
2e26976d25586891d30fe4e4e50a089ce6da5e365374d9a9e538cd757babe6e9
spent
true